At Movies now...checked in yesterday....in a renovated preferred room in Toy Story, Buzz Section, building 10, first floor room....we hate the new design...It looks like a sterile hospital room with a few pictures of Disney - it could also be a generic hotel anywhere. While I love the flooring, we found that there were no luggage racks to put your suitcases on and while they say you can store your suitcases under the bed, ours did not fit and there is no clock in the room. The closet area was WAY too small - there is just 2 of us and we are finding it small...the beds are super comfy (I was asleep in 5 minutes last night) but they are high. My Mom said the murphy bed was comfy but there was no comforter or duvet on it just a blanket so luckily we always travel with a blanket. We are hoping it was just an oversight when our room was made up so if still the same way today I will call for extra blankets or a duvet. I am not a fan of the new tub area. The tub is high and it has a metal lip on the top so the sliding glass doors can slide and I hit my toe getting out yesterday (ouch). There are no grab bars in the tub/shower area and my Mom's suction cup handle will not stick and there is nothing to hold onto to get in or out of the shower/tub. The rainforest head, while some will love, is horrible. We both have thick hair and it took forever to get the shampoo out. I wish they had given both shower heads with a choice. There is also no where to put your face cloth and you have to be a contorshonist (sp?) to get your toilet paper - it is behind to the side of the toilet (because of the pocket doors). Also, when the murphy bed is down the corners stick out - we used lots of bath towels to cover the corners. I am afraid that a child is going to fall and hit their head on the corner. Someone asked about where to out a pack and play and I would think it would fit between the coffee area and the dresser but the a/c blows right on that area. Also when the murphy bed is down, you lose the table and I like to be on my computer and am using the dresser with a chair in front - not ideal but it works.
